Lightnin’ strikes quick on faltering Diamonds
(Nashville Banner, 08.07.82)
CHARLOTTE, N.C. — The Nashville Diamonds (2-17-3) ran their winless streak to 11 games Friday with a 3-1 loss here to the Carolina Lightnin’ (8-10-3)
After 60 minutes of shutout soccer, the Lightnin’ struck for two quick goals — both by Pat Fidelia — in a four minute period to take a 2-0 lead. Fidelia got his first on an unassisted effort following a corner kick, then took Redmond Lane’s pass in for the second.
Nashville sliced the margin to 2-1 when Michael Harderson rebounded a missed shot in the 87th minute, but Fidelia then assisted in David Pierce’s goal one minute later to ice the contest.
